1:03:06Now PlayingIn this Lawton Online, the one year anniversary of the podcast, Andrew chats with the Canadian Shooting Sports Association's Tony Bernardo about a Liberal Senator's gun bill that could spell disaster for Canadian gun owners. He also tackles the media's and the left's "endless fawning" over convicted murderer and terrorist Omar Khadr's upcoming marriage. Rebel Commander Ezra Levant also makes an appearance to talk about the future of the Rebel and of media in Canada. And Andrew has a special announcement. MORE
